In today’s rapidly evolving landscape of sensor technology, maintenance and reliability
professionals face a critical decision: stick with the proven methods of traditional on-site
vibration analysis, or embrace the continuous, real-time insights offered by modern
wireless sensor solutions. This presentation dissects both methodologies, providing a
balanced, in-depth analysis that empowers you to make informed decisions tailored to
your operational needs. By blending real-world scenarios with robust case study data,
you’ll gain the clarity necessary to navigate this complex technological terrain.

Practical Takeaways: By the end of this session, you will be equipped with actionable
strategies to:
• Evaluate and select the optimal condition monitoring tools for your specific
applications.
• Seamlessly integrate continuous wireless monitoring with traditional measurement
techniques.
• Maximize your ROI by aligning technology investments with operational realities.
• Overcome challenges related to data management and sensor deployment,
ensuring reliability and efficiency.

Biography

Andy has 19 years of experience in the industrial equipment health monitoring industry, with a particular emphasis on condition monitoring and predictive maintenance (PdM). His expertise is bolstered by certifications including CMRP from SMRP, Level II vibration analysis from the Vibration Institute, and a recent certification in Convolutional Neural Networks with TensorFlow. Over the past decade, Andy has increasingly focused on integrating AI-driven solutions into IIOT devices and software platforms, playing a key role in advancing Industry 4.0 within industrial operations, maintenance, and automation.
